Taia Mall'ae (TIE-uh MAL-ay), or Tai, as she was called, stood at the front of her ship. The beautiful tropical sun beat down on her face, warming her lightly tanned features. The brisk ocean breeze carried with it the pleasant salty tang that she had come to know and love. It seemed to dance playfully with her silky blonde locks. Raising her arms to the sky, she chanted her magical words, and the wind was suddenly behind them, pushing her proud vessel forward with great speed. Windcatcher's like her were rare and valuable in the archipelago. Their magical ability to control the weather mad them an important part of commerce in the area. Tai was young for a Windcatcher, especially one so powerful, at just 20 years old. She had captained this ship for almost two years now. She left the prow, heading for her quarters. Her heeled boots tapped against the worn boards.
A crewman in the crows nest called out, pointing out to sea. "Ship ahoy!" Pulling out her telescope, she peered in the direction he pointed. Her heart fluttered in fear. It was the fleet of Warlord Garret. They were known to pirate peaceful merchants, and worse... If he got a hold of a Windcatcher... he could rule the seas with an iron fist. She raised her melodic voice and shouted. "Hard to starboard!" They turned, and they turned again, and again. Four ships closed steadily on their position. Taia felt fear begin to settle in her stomach. They were going to be captured.
She offered herself willingly when they reached her, and the men agreed to spare her crew, and drop them off at the next island. Her fate, however, was to remain their prisoner. A strong, breathtakingly handsome man approached her, his eyes boring into her soul. His calloused hands lifted her chin. "You belong to me now, Windcatcher." She shuddered as he clasped a thin black leather collar snugly around her slim neck. One of his crewman bound her hands behind her back. "I am Garret." He raised his hand, showing her a silver ring on his left hand. "This ring is magically linked to your collar. It prevents you from using magic without my permission. You will feel what I wish you to feel, and perform the tasks I wish you to perform. Get that through your pretty little head. Understand?"
She said nothing, a defiant glint in her eyes. He chuckled, looking away. "Take her to the ship, and find her some quarters. We will have use for her soon enough."
